i have a pair of the ecco cage sport, though they're about 5 years old or so ... they were def not $100 when i bought them ... they are a solid shoe, but since i bought them i've become a monthly member at rtj, so i play primarily in the morning while walking and need a fully leather shoe ... bought another pair of eccos ... i believe they do make them in a wide version, but cannot state that for fact ... if you don't walk or play early with the dew out, that'd be a good price for them ...
just as a psa, if you buy shoes with replaceable cleats, buy extra cleats when you buy the shoes ... don't wait till they need replacing, because by then a few of them will be damned near impossible to get out ... check em every now and then and replace one or two at a time as needed ...
i've learned that the hard way ...
